Amy Thomas

Amy Thomas is Chief Operating Officer of Penumbra. A nonprofit leader working at the intersection of arts and social justice, Thomas’ work includes leading organizations in inspired storytelling processes to growing organizational capacity and sustainability. She has over 20 years of nonprofit management and administrative experience with organizations ranging from major public universities to exhibition management services. As part of the executive leadership team at Penumbra, she is responsible for the business, administrative, and operational management. Prior to her work at Penumbra, she led the marketing, communications, and audience engagement initiatives for ArtPower! at the University of California, San Diego and The Broad Stage in Santa Monica. She was part of the creative and management team behind The Loft, a 250-capacity performance lounge and restaurant voted “Best Venue in San Diego.” She co-led the Place Matters Project, an interdisciplinary year-long residency exploring the nature of community with the Urban Bush Women, students, faculty and administrators. Thomas has a B.A. from the University of California, San Diego; she was a visiting scholar at the University of California, Berkeley. She is Master of Public Affairs graduate at the University of Minnesota, a Global Arts Management Fellow at the University of Maryland, and serves as a board member for Urban Roots.
